    Ladyrose- Hun those levels are fine!! If you type in hcg doubling calculators you can use that to see roughly how much they are doubling within a timeframe. I typed yours in (because I'm anal lol) and your last three results were doubling every 55-57 hours...that's in a normal timeframe! For levels under 1200 a timeframe of 31-72 hours is expected, levels between 1200- 6000 it's 48-96 hrs and levels over 6000 96+hrs.
